Season 1
1 :01x01 - Brooke's First Date (Jul/10/2005)
At sixteen years old, Brooke Hogan is ready to start dating, but the Hulk is far from it. The Hogan household heats up when a 22-year-old college guy asks Brooke out on her first date! Linda teams up with Brooke to talk Dad into letting her go, but Dad isn't giving up yet, he's tracking them by GPS! See what happens when Hulk takes on his greatest challenge, his daughter's first date.

2 :01x02 - Nick's Girlfriend (Jul/17/2005)
At fourteen years old, Nick Hogan is quite the ladies man. His infatuation with his new girlfriend Ashley has him heading for trouble as he begins blowing off the family, school, and even his cars to be with her. As Hulk and Linda try to get Nick back on track, they discover condoms in Nick's room. Don't miss this Hulk match up as he takes on Nick's fourteen-year-old girlfriend!

3 :01x03 - Brooke's Big Break (Jul/24/2005)
Dad and Brooke struggle to find the right team to launch Brooke's music career as they wade through an outlandish cast of music industry players and pretenders. Dad, in his usual overprotective mode, coaches Brooke on the sacrifices it takes to make it big. Join Hulk, Brooke, and the Hogan family as they hit the grammys in L.A. and try to bodyslam the music industry.

4 :01x04 - Wrestlemania (Jul/31/2005)
Hulk is invited by Vince McMahon to be inducted into the Wrestling Hall of Fame and surprises Hulk with an invitation to wrestle at Wrestlemania 21 in Los Angeles. The family worries Dad will get hurt or worse, hit the road wrestling again. Watch Hulk lead his family behind the scenes of the barbaric world of wrestling, as `Dad' transforms into `Hulk Hogan'!

5 :01x05 - Romantic Getaway (Aug/14/2005)
Hulk and Linda decide to take a romantic weekend getaway and ride off into the sunset in a Hummer limousine. While they're away, sidekick and former wrestler Brian "Nasty Boy" Knobs will baby-sit. Nick and Brooke decide to take advantage of the situation and ask Knobs if they can have some people sleep over. Trying to be cool baby sitters, he agrees. The sleepover gets out of hand when some of their friends show up. Meanwhile, Hulk and Linda are enjoying a romantic dinner alone, despite the many interruptions from wrestling fans

6 :01x06 - Hogan Versus City Hall (Aug/21/2005)
The Hogan family is at war with the town of Bellaire, Florida over the number of pets they have. The onetime menagerie of more than a dozen has been whittled down to five animals plus a permitted rooster after their next-door neighbor complained to the town. But Bellaire officials are playing hardball: They send the Hogans a letter saying the family is in violation of the town code, and a hearing is scheduled. After another heated confrontation between Linda and the neighbor's gardener, they go to the hearing. Will the Hogans have to give up their precious pets? Or will the family stand strong on principle?

7 :01x07 - Hulk's Hobbies (Sep/04/2005)
After 25 years on the road wrestling, Hulk has always had an outlet for his energy and aggression by body-slamming people nightly. Now that he's home, he's bored and antsy -- and driving his family nuts. Brooke, Nick and Linda all try to find Hulk a hobby. First Hulk tries golf at an exclusive country club -- but he's much too tense for that. Next he tries tennis, but ends up drinking beer on the court with a buddy. Finally, Brooke suggests pilates -- is this what Hulk needs to loosen him up?
